The 1914 Star awarded to Private Ernest Millington, 2nd Battalion the Worcestershire Regiment who landed in France on the 12th of August 1914, who was Wounded in 1918 and finally Discharged with Melancholia in August 1919 comprising, 1914 Star, (7459 Pte E. Millington. 2/Worc: R.), The 1914 Star awarded to Driver Ernest R.J. Herbert. 4th Signal Company Royal Engineers comprising, 1914 Star, entitled to Aug-Nov Clasp, (25229 Dvr: E.R.J. Herbert. R.E.), The 1914 Star awarded to Gunner Robert Henderson, Royal Marine Brigade, Artillery Division comprising, 1914 Star, (R.M.A.3147. Gunner R. Henderson. R.M. Brigade.), very fine (3)
Pte Millington is Entitled to Silver War Badge B278592
Sold with Copy Medal Index Card, Copy Medal Rolls, Copy Pension Details and copy SWB Roll
Driver Herbert landed in France on the 22nd of August 1914
Sold with Copy Medal Index Card and Copy Medal Rolls
Gunner Henderson was born in October 1869, he stated he was a Draper when he enlisted on the 13th of November 1896. His Papers state Died 15th February 1951 Sold with Copy Medal Roll confirming 1914 Star and Copy Service Papers.
